The Beach
Like the soundtracks for Danny Boyle's other films, the music collected for his
adaptation of Alex Garland's novel The Beach is a hip mix
of British and American rock and electronica. Asian Dub Foundation's
"Return of Django," Moby's "Porcelain,"
Leftfield's "Snake Blood," and the Hardfloor remix
of Mory Kante's "Yeke Yeke" are among the album's
electronic highlights, while Blur's "On Your Own (Crouch
End Broadway Mix)" and New Order's "Brutal"
add a touch of British pop to the set. "Business as Usual"
is a collaboration between Barry Adamson (whose albums seem
more filmic than most scores) and the film's star, Leonardo
DiCaprio; composer Angelo Badalamenti and Orbital collaborate
on "Orbital Mix."
All Saints and Sugar Ray contribute
the previously unreleased tracks "Pure Shores" and
"Spinning Away" respectively, making The Beach an
entertaining, if somewhat scattered, collection of music featured
in the film.
